产品分享社区
声明:网站上的服务均为第三方提供,请用户注意甄别服务质量
2026年,球鞋发售已经从“手动拼手速”演变为“自动化拼资源”。对于抢鞋工作室来说,真正决定胜负的,不只是脚本本身,而是背后的网络环境与代理IP配置能力。无论是多账号运营、批量养号,还是发售瞬间的高并发抢购,代理IP都是整个自动化体系中不可或缺的核心基础。
本文将从工作室实战角度出发,系统拆解自动化抢鞋中代理IP的关键作用,并提供从养号到抢购阶段的完整配置思路,帮助你搭建一套稳定、高成功率的抢鞋方案。
对于个人玩家来说,自动化抢鞋可能只是提升一点效率;但对于抢鞋工作室而言,本质上是在进行一场“规模化并发竞争”。如果没有合理的代理IP配置,工作室的账号体系、任务并发能力以及整体成功率都会受到严重限制。
抢鞋工作室通常会同时运营几十甚至上百个账号,用于参与不同平台或同一发售的多次尝试。
但平台风控系统会重点检测以下行为:
一旦触发规则,可能出现账号封禁、抽签资格失效,甚至下单被取消等情形。
因此在工作室场景中,代理IP的核心作用是:
抢鞋工作室的核心优势在于同时运行大量任务,但问题在于:单一IP无法承载高并发请求。
如果多个任务集中在少量IP上,会导致:
通过轮换代理IP池,工作室可以实现:
对于工作室而言,抢鞋Bot通常是7×24小时运行,并覆盖多个发售周期。但在实际运行中,如果没有稳定的代理IP支持,会出现:
一个高质量的代理IP体系,需要具备:
成熟的抢鞋工作室通常不会只盯一个市场,而是同时布局多个地区。但大多数平台会基于IP判断用户地区,限制访问或参与资格。
通过代理IP,工作室可以实现:
对于工作室来说,短期抢到几双鞋并不难,难的是长期稳定、不被封地持续运行。
平台的风控策略不断升级,包括:
如果代理IP质量不足,会导致:
对于抢鞋工作室来说,代理IP的配置不是简单“接入即可”,而是需要根据不同业务阶段,拆分为注册养号阶段 + 抢购冲刺阶段两套不同的策略。
核心逻辑可以总结为:
在实际操作中,工作室往往需要批量准备大量账号,用于参与不同平台的发售、抽签或排队机制。但在这个过程中,最常见的问题并不是账号数量不足,而是:
这些问题的本质,其实都指向网络环境不稳定或不可信。而静态住宅代理IP可以有效解决以上问题,确保账号环境长期稳定且可信。在实际部署中,不少工作室会使用IPFoxy 的静态住宅代理,用于多账号注册和养号,稳定性强、IP纯净度高。
相比动态代理,静态住宅IP更适合注册和养号阶段,原因在于它更接近“真实用户”的网络特征:
当进入发售瞬间,抢鞋工作室的核心目标转为在极短时间内发起大规模请求,抢占库存与位置。
但在这个阶段,也会产生以下问题:
这些问题的本质在于IP资源无法支撑高并发请求,因此,在自动化抢鞋阶段,工作室通常会切换为动态住宅代理IP,通过持续轮换IP来支撑大规模任务运行。
动态住宅代理的核心作用:
步骤1:接入动态代理IP池
IPFoxy 动态代理通常提供大规模住宅IP资源,并支持会话控制和自动轮换机制。可根据需求将代理信息接入脚本环境,作为请求出口,以下代码用于测试代理是否成功连接。
import urllib.request
proxy = urllib.request.ProxyHandler({
'http': 'username:password@gateway.ipfoxy.com:port',
'https': 'username:password@gateway.ipfoxy.com:port'
})
opener = urllib.request.build_opener(proxy)
urllib.request.install_opener(opener)
response = urllib.request.urlopen('http://httpbin.org/ip')
print(response.read())
步骤2:多线程并发请求,模拟抢购任务
该代码演示如何使用多个代理IP同时发起请求,模拟抢鞋Bot中的并发任务逻辑。
import requests
import threading
proxy_pool = [
'http://user:pass@gateway.ipfoxy.com:port1',
'http://user:pass@gateway.ipfoxy.com:port2',
]
def task(proxy):
try:
r = requests.get('https://example.com', proxies={
'http': proxy,
'https': proxy
}, timeout=5)
print("成功:", proxy)
except:
print("失败:", proxy)
threads = []
for i in range(50):
proxy = proxy_pool[i % len(proxy_pool)]
t = threading.Thread(target=task, args=(proxy,))
threads.append(t)
t.start()
步骤3:请求频率控制,降低风控风险
通过随机延迟控制请求节奏,避免所有请求同时发送,从而降低被平台识别为自动化行为的概率。
import time, random
time.sleep(random.uniform(0.5, 2.0))
步骤4:失败重试与IP切换机制
当请求失败时,自动切换新的代理IP并重试,有助于提升整体成功率并减少任务中断。
def retry_task(max_retry=3):
for _ in range(max_retry):
proxy = get_new_proxy()
if task(proxy):
return True
time.sleep(1)
return False
三、常见问题(FAQ)
1.一个代理IP可以同时跑多少个任务?
不建议多个高频任务共享同一个IP。在高并发阶段,尽量做到一任务一IP或轮换使用IP池,否则容易整体失败。
2.代理延迟会影响抢鞋结果吗?
会。发售瞬间通常是毫秒级竞争,延迟越低越有优势。建议选择靠近发售地区的节点IP,减少网络传输时间。
3.是否需要自己维护代理池?
如果规模较小,可以直接使用服务商提供的IP池。当任务量较大时,可以结合API动态获取IP,实现更灵活调度。
四、总结
自动化抢鞋的本质,不只是“更快”,而是“更稳定、更可规模化”。从前期账号养号,到后期高并发抢购,每一个环节都离不开合理的代理IP配置作为支撑。只有在稳定性与并发能力之间找到平衡,才能持续提升整体成功率。